Kmart's "KartWheels for Kids" Holiday Toy Drive A Success — Boys & Girls Clubs of Northern Westchester Receives 100 Donated Toys.
The holiday season was made a little brighter for children at the Boys & Girls Clubs of Northern Westchester due, in part, to the generosity of shoppers at two local Kmart locations. "KartWheels for Kids," Kmart's annual holiday toy drive, collected 100 toys for members at the Clubs' three locations (Mount Kisco, Tarrytown, and Yorktown).
"We are extremely grateful to Kmart for holding this toy drive," said Brian Skanes, executive director of the Boys & Girls Clubs of Northern Westchester. "So many of the kids we serve would not have received a toy for the holidays otherwise."
The Boys & Girls Clubs of Northern Westchester visited the Kmart Stores located in Yorktown Heights (355 Downing Drive) and Mahopac (987 Route 6) each week in December to collect toys donated by holiday shoppers. Donated toys were then distributed to children at the Clubs' Holiday Party.
About the Boys & Girls Clubs of Northern Westchester
The Boys & Girls Clubs of Northern Westchester was established in 1939 as a place for "boys to get off the streets." It is a non-profit organization dedicated to the service of all youth with a primary focus on children with special needs. The main unit in Mt. Kisco, NY is a 36,000-square-foot facility featuring an eight-lane pool, Child Care Center, gymnasium, games room, two computer labs and an additional 1,600-foot Teen Center facility. The Club has two satellite programs: a youth and teen center in the Yorktown Community Center; and a full service program at The Community Opportunity Center in Tarrytown, NY. The Boys & Girls Clubs of Northern Westchester serves more than 6,000 youths, boys and girls ages 6 months to 18 years, from more than 60 Northern Westchester communities. The Club has been ranked among the outstanding Clubs in the national network of Boys & Girls Clubs of America.
